Would that work? I bought a silkie at a chicken show and she smelled like cat flea powder. It seems like I remember reading somewhere that flea powder works. I would be nervous eating eggs from a hen that was dusted, but my silkie is not laying yet. Anyone heard of this?
 
You can bathe in kitten (not cat) flea shampoo with complete safety.
I am not big on using any powder... birds have very sensitive lungs and it must not be forgotten that these powders are meant to ONLY be used on the outside of the bird and most can and do cause injury when inhaled. You could also look in a pet store for the special pump action spray that may be used ON the birds ... they also have such for pigeons which will work equally well. (Take care to protect the eyes and nares)
